@font-face{font-display:swap;font-family:Nunito;src:url(/fonts/Nunito.woff2) format("woff2"),url(/fonts/Nunito.woff) format("woff"),url(/fonts/Nunito.ttf) format("truetype");unicode-range:u+0-ff,u+131,u+152,u+153,u+2bb,u+2bc,u+2c6,u+2da,u+2dc,u+2000-206f,u+2074,u+20ac,u+2122,u+2191,u+2193,u+2212,u+2215,u+feff,u+fffd}@font-face{font-display:swap;font-family:BebasNeue-Regular;src:url(/fonts/BebasNeue-Regular.woff2) format("woff2"),url(/fonts/BebasNeue-Regular.woff) format("woff"),url(/fonts/BebasNeue-Regular.ttf) format("truetype");unicode-range:u+0-ff,u+131,u+152,u+153,u+2bb,u+2bc,u+2c6,u+2da,u+2dc,u+2000-206f,u+2074,u+20ac,u+2122,u+2191,u+2193,u+2212,u+2215,u+feff,u+fffd}button{align-items:center;-moz-appearance:none;-webkit-appearance:none;border:1px solid transparent;border-radius:4px;box-shadow:none;display:inline-flex;font-size:1rem;height:2.5em;justify-content:flex-start;line-height:1.5;padding:calc(.5em - 1px) calc(.75em - 1px);position:relative;vertical-align:top}button.is-active,button:active,button:focus{outline:none}button{-webkit-touch-callout:none;-webkit-user-select:none;-moz-user-select:none;user-select:none}.box:not(:last-child),h1:not(:last-child),h2:not(:last-child),h3:not(:last-child),p:not(:last-child){margin-bottom:1.5rem}.navbar-burger{-moz-appearance:none;-webkit-appearance:none;appearance:none;background:none;border:none;color:#4a4a4a;cursor:pointer;display:block;font-family:inherit;font-size:1em;height:3rem;margin:0 0 0 auto;padding:0;position:relative;width:3.5rem}body,h1,h2,h3,html,li,p,ul{margin:0;padding:0}h1,h2,h3{font-size:100%;font-weight:400}ul{list-style:circle}button{margin:0}html{background-color:#efefef;box-sizing:border-box;font-size:16px;-moz-osx-font-smoothing:grayscale;-webkit-font-smoothing:antialiased;min-width:300px;overflow-x:hidden;overflow-y:scroll;text-rendering:optimizeLegibility;-webkit-text-size-adjust:100%;-moz-text-size-adjust:100%;text-size-adjust:100%;scroll-behavior:smooth;scroll-snap-type:y proximity}*,:after,:before{box-sizing:inherit}img{height:auto;max-width:100%}footer,section{display:block}body,button{font-family:Nunito,BlinkMacSystemFont,-apple-system,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,Helvetica,Arial,sans-serif}body{color:#4a4a4a;font-size:clamp(1.1rem,2vw + .5rem,1.3rem);font-weight:400;line-height:1.5}a{color:#86a623;cursor:pointer;-webkit-text-decoration:none;text-decoration:none}a strong{color:currentColor}a:hover{color:#363636}img{height:auto;max-width:100%}span{font-style:inherit;font-weight:inherit}strong{color:#dcb939;font-weight:700}@keyframes spinAround{0%{transform:rotate(0deg)}to{transform:rotate(359deg)}}.box{background-color:#fff;border-radius:20px;box-shadow:0 .5em 1em -.125em rgba(0,0,0,.1),0 0 0 1px rgba(0,0,0,.02);color:#4a4a4a;display:block;padding:0}a.box:focus,a.box:hover{box-shadow:0 .5em 1em -.125em rgba(0,0,0,.1),0 0 0 1px #86a623}a.box:active{box-shadow:inset 0 1px 2px rgba(0,0,0,.2),0 0 0 1px #86a623}button{background-color:#efefef;border-color:#dbdbdb;border-width:1px;color:#dcb939;cursor:pointer;font-weight:700;justify-content:center;padding:calc(.5em - 1px) 1em;text-align:center;white-space:nowrap}button strong{color:inherit}button:hover{border-color:#b5b5b5;color:#363636}button:focus{border-color:#485fc7;color:#363636}button:focus:not(:active){box-shadow:0 0 0 .125em rgba(134,166,35,.25)}button.is-active,button:active{border-color:#4a4a4a;color:#363636}button.is-primary{background-color:#62781e;border-color:transparent;color:#fff}button.is-primary:hover{background-color:#5a6e1b;border-color:transparent;color:#fff}button.is-primary:focus{border-color:transparent;color:#fff}button.is-primary:focus:not(:active){box-shadow:0 0 0 .125em rgba(98,120,30,.25)}button.is-primary.is-active,button.is-primary:active{background-color:#516419;border-color:transparent;color:#fff}button.is-link{background-color:#86a623;border-color:transparent;color:#fff}button.is-link:hover{background-color:#7e9b21;border-color:transparent;color:#fff}button.is-link:focus{border-color:transparent;color:#fff}button.is-link:focus:not(:active){box-shadow:0 0 0 .125em rgba(134,166,35,.25)}button.is-link.is-active,button.is-link:active{background-color:#75911f;border-color:transparent;color:#fff}.container{flex-grow:1;margin:0 auto;position:relative;width:auto}p li+li{margin-top:.25em}p p:not(:last-child),p ul:not(:last-child){margin-bottom:1em}p h1,p h2,p h3{color:#dcb939;font-weight:600;line-height:1.125}p h1{font-size:2em;margin-bottom:.5em}p h1:not(:first-child){margin-top:1em}p h2{font-size:1.75em;margin-bottom:.5714em}p h2:not(:first-child){margin-top:1.1428em}p h3{font-size:1.5em;margin-bottom:.6666em}p h3:not(:first-child){margin-top:1.3333em}p ul{list-style:disc outside;margin-left:2em;margin-top:1em}p ul ul{list-style-type:circle;margin-top:.5em}p ul ul ul{list-style-type:square}@keyframes moveIndeterminate{0%{background-position:200% 0}to{background-position:-200% 0}}h1,h1+h2,h2,h2+h2,h2+h3,h3{word-break:break-word}h1 span,h2 span,h2+h2 span,h3 span{font-weight:inherit}h1,h2,h3{color:#dcb939;font-size:2.125rem;font-weight:600;line-height:1.125}h1 strong,h2 strong,h3 strong{color:inherit;font-weight:inherit}h1:not(.is-spaced)+h2,h2:not(.is-spaced)+h2,h2:not(.is-spaced)+h3{margin-top:-1.25rem}h1{font-size:3.4rem}h2{font-size:2.55rem}h3{font-size:2.125rem}h1.is-4,h2.is-4,h3.is-4{font-size:1.5rem}h1+h2,h2+h2,h2+h3{color:#4a4a4a;font-size:1.25rem;font-weight:400;line-height:1.25}h1+h2 strong,h2+h2 strong,h2+h3 strong{color:#dcb939;font-weight:600}h1+h2:not(.is-spaced)+h1,h1+h2:not(.is-spaced)+h2,h1+h2:not(.is-spaced)+h3,h2+h2:not(.is-spaced)+h1,h2+h2:not(.is-spaced)+h2,h2+h2:not(.is-spaced)+h3,h2+h3:not(.is-spaced)+h1,h2+h3:not(.is-spaced)+h2,h2+h3:not(.is-spaced)+h3{margin-top:-1.25rem}h1+h2,h2+h2{font-size:2.55rem}h2+h3{font-size:2.125rem}h1+h2.is-4,h2+h2.is-4,h2+h3.is-4{font-size:1.5rem}.navbar{background-color:#efefef;background:none;min-height:3.5rem;position:relative;transition:background .5s ease;z-index:30}.navbar.is-primary{background-color:#62781e;color:#fff}.navbar.is-primary .navbar-brand>.navbar-item{color:#fff}.navbar.is-primary .navbar-brand>a.navbar-item.is-active,.navbar.is-primary .navbar-brand>a.navbar-item:focus,.navbar.is-primary .navbar-brand>a.navbar-item:hover{background-color:#516419;color:#fff}.navbar.is-primary .navbar-burger{color:#fff}.navbar.is-link{background-color:#86a623;color:#fff}.navbar.is-link .navbar-brand>.navbar-item{color:#fff}.navbar.is-link .navbar-brand>a.navbar-item.is-active,.navbar.is-link .navbar-brand>a.navbar-item:focus,.navbar.is-link .navbar-brand>a.navbar-item:hover{background-color:#75911f;color:#fff}.navbar.is-link .navbar-burger{color:#fff}.navbar>.container{align-items:stretch;display:flex;min-height:3.5rem;width:100%}.navbar{left:0;position:fixed;right:0;z-index:30}.navbar{top:0}.navbar-brand{align-items:stretch;display:flex;flex-shrink:0;min-height:3.5rem}.navbar-brand a.navbar-item:focus,.navbar-brand a.navbar-item:hover{background-color:transparent}.navbar-burger span{background-color:currentColor;display:block;height:1px;left:calc(50% - 8px);position:absolute;transform-origin:center;transition-duration:86ms;transition-property:background-color,opacity,transform;transition-timing-function:ease-out;width:16px}.navbar-burger span:first-child{top:calc(50% - 6px)}.navbar-burger span:nth-child(2){top:calc(50% - 1px)}.navbar-burger span:nth-child(3){top:calc(50% + 4px)}.navbar-burger:hover{background-color:rgba(0,0,0,.05)}.navbar-burger.is-active span:first-child{transform:translateY(5px) rotate(45deg)}.navbar-burger.is-active span:nth-child(2){opacity:0}.navbar-burger.is-active span:nth-child(3){transform:translateY(-5px) rotate(-45deg)}.navbar-menu{display:none}.navbar-item{color:#4a4a4a;display:block;line-height:1.5;padding:.5rem max(.5rem,min(1vw,2rem));position:relative}a.navbar-item{cursor:pointer}a.navbar-item.is-active,a.navbar-item:focus,a.navbar-item:focus-within,a.navbar-item:hover{background-color:#fafafa;color:#86a623}.navbar-item{flex-grow:0;flex-shrink:0}.navbar-item img{max-height:1.75rem}.column{display:block;flex-basis:auto;flex-grow:1;flex-shrink:1;padding:.75rem}.columns{flex-direction:column;margin:0}.columns:last-child{margin-bottom:-.75rem}.columns:not(:last-child){margin-bottom:.75rem}.has-text-white{color:#fff!important}a.has-text-white:focus,a.has-text-white:hover{color:#e6e6e6!important}.has-background-link{background-color:#86a623!important}.navbar{font-size:1.25rem!important}.has-text-centered{text-align:center!important}.navbar{text-transform:uppercase!important}.is-hidden{display:none!important}.hero{align-items:stretch;display:flex;flex-direction:column;justify-content:space-between}.hero .navbar{background:none}.hero.is-primary{background-color:#62781e;color:#fff}.hero.is-primary a:not(.button):not(button):not(.dropdown-item):not(.tag):not(.pagination-link.is-current),.hero.is-primary strong{color:inherit}.hero.is-primary h1,.hero.is-primary h2,.hero.is-primary h3{color:#fff}.hero.is-primary h1+h2,.hero.is-primary h2+h2,.hero.is-primary h2+h3{color:hsla(0,0%,100%,.9)}.hero.is-primary h1+h2 a:not(.button):not(button),.hero.is-primary h1+h2 strong,.hero.is-primary h2+h2 a:not(.button):not(button),.hero.is-primary h2+h2 strong,.hero.is-primary h2+h3 a:not(.button):not(button),.hero.is-primary h2+h3 strong{color:#fff}.hero.is-primary .navbar-item{color:hsla(0,0%,100%,.7)}.hero.is-primary a.navbar-item.is-active,.hero.is-primary a.navbar-item:hover{background-color:#516419;color:#fff}.hero.is-link{background-color:#86a623;color:#fff}.hero.is-link a:not(.button):not(button):not(.dropdown-item):not(.tag):not(.pagination-link.is-current),.hero.is-link strong{color:inherit}.hero.is-link h1,.hero.is-link h2,.hero.is-link h3{color:#fff}.hero.is-link h1+h2,.hero.is-link h2+h2,.hero.is-link h2+h3{color:hsla(0,0%,100%,.9)}.hero.is-link h1+h2 a:not(.button):not(button),.hero.is-link h1+h2 strong,.hero.is-link h2+h2 a:not(.button):not(button),.hero.is-link h2+h2 strong,.hero.is-link h2+h3 a:not(.button):not(button),.hero.is-link h2+h3 strong{color:#fff}.hero.is-link .navbar-item{color:hsla(0,0%,100%,.7)}.hero.is-link a.navbar-item.is-active,.hero.is-link a.navbar-item:hover{background-color:#75911f;color:#fff}.hero.is-fullheight .hero-body{align-items:center;display:flex}.hero.is-fullheight .hero-body>.container{flex-grow:1;flex-shrink:1}.hero.is-fullheight{min-height:100vh}.hero-head{flex-grow:0;flex-shrink:0}.hero-body{align-items:center;flex-grow:1;flex-shrink:0}.hero-body{padding:3rem 1.5rem}:root{--stroke-color:#86a623}h1,h2,h3{letter-spacing:.1rem}h1,h2{font-family:BebasNeue-Regular,sans-serif}h1{color:#62781e;font-size:clamp(2.7rem,4vw + 1.4rem,3.4rem)!important;text-transform:uppercase}h1+h2{-webkit-text-stroke:2px #86a623;-webkit-text-stroke:2px var(--stroke-color);color:transparent!important}h2{color:#86a623;font-size:clamp(2.2rem,4vw + 1rem,2.55rem)!important;font-weight:400}h2+h2{-webkit-text-stroke:2px #86a623;-webkit-text-stroke:2px var(--stroke-color);color:transparent!important}.bold{font-weight:700}h3{color:#86a623;font-size:clamp(1.9rem,4vw + .5rem,2.125rem)}.navbar-end{background:#efefef;text-align:right}.navbar-brand,.navbar-item,.navbar-menu{flex-shrink:1}.navbar-brand{max-height:3rem}.navbar-brand>.navbar-item>picture{display:flex}.navbar-item img{margin-right:min(.7vw,.5rem)}.navbar-brand,.navbar-burger{transition:all .3s ease-in-out}.hero-head{padding:3rem 3rem 1.5rem}#first-section{font-size:clamp(1.2rem,2.5vw - .5rem,1.6rem);padding:1.5rem max(1.5rem,min(7vw,8rem))}#first-section>div{padding:1.5rem max(1.5rem,min(4%,3rem))}#first-section>picture>img{position:absolute;width:auto;z-index:-1}#first-section>picture:first-child>img{left:0;max-height:35vh;max-width:35vw;top:0}#first-section>picture:last-child>img{bottom:0;max-height:75vh;max-width:75vw;right:0}#first-section .box{background:hsla(0,0%,94%,.85)}#creations .column,#creations .hero-body{padding-left:0;padding-right:0}#creations .column{display:grid}#creations .column.left{padding-right:1.5rem}#creations .column.left picture:first-of-type{grid-area:1/1/7/13}#creations .column.left picture{grid-area:3/2/6/15}#creations .column.right{align-content:end;justify-content:end;padding-left:1.5rem;place-content:end}#creations .column.right h1{color:#86a623;margin:2rem;position:absolute;right:3rem;top:2rem}#creations .column.right picture:first-of-type{grid-area:1/1/10/10}#creations .column.right picture{grid-area:3/2/11/8}section{scroll-margin-top:3.5rem;scroll-snap-align:start}section,section>picture{overflow:hidden;position:relative}section>picture{height:30vh}section>picture>img{height:100%;left:30%;max-width:none;min-width:100vw;position:absolute;transform:translateX(-30%);width:auto}.is-link{background:#86a623;color:#fff;--stroke-color:#efefef}.is-link h1,.is-link h2{color:#efefef}.is-back-primary{background:#62781e;color:#fff;--stroke-color:#efefef}.is-back-primary h1,.is-back-primary h2{color:#efefef}.left-border{border-left:3px solid #dcb939;padding-left:max(1rem,min(4%,3rem))}.left-border h2:not(:first-child){padding-top:1.5rem}.left-border h2:nth-of-type(2n){color:#dcb939}.left-border h2:nth-of-type(odd){color:#86a623}.profile{width:max(200px,min(25vmax,400px))}button.is-link:hover{background-color:#62781e}footer{background-color:#fafafa;padding:3rem 1.5rem;scroll-snap-align:end}ul:not(:last-child){margin-bottom:1.5rem}#contact h3{margin:0;padding:1rem}#contact img{padding-bottom:1rem}@media screen and (min-width:769px){.columns.is-tablet{flex-direction:row}.reverse.is-tablet{flex-direction:row-reverse}}@media screen and (min-width:1024px){.container{max-width:600px}.navbar.is-primary .navbar-end>.navbar-item{color:#fff}.navbar.is-primary .navbar-end>a.navbar-item.is-active,.navbar.is-primary .navbar-end>a.navbar-item:focus,.navbar.is-primary .navbar-end>a.navbar-item:hover{background-color:#516419;color:#fff}.navbar.is-link .navbar-end>.navbar-item{color:#fff}.navbar.is-link .navbar-end>a.navbar-item.is-active,.navbar.is-link .navbar-end>a.navbar-item:focus,.navbar.is-link .navbar-end>a.navbar-item:hover{background-color:#75911f;color:#fff}.navbar,.navbar-end,.navbar-menu{align-items:stretch;display:flex}.navbar{min-height:3.5rem}.navbar-burger{display:none}.navbar-item{align-items:center;display:flex}.navbar-menu{flex-grow:1;flex-shrink:0}.navbar-end{justify-content:flex-end;margin-left:auto}.container>.navbar .navbar-brand,.navbar>.container .navbar-brand{margin-left:-.75rem}.container>.navbar .navbar-menu,.navbar>.container .navbar-menu{margin-right:-.75rem}a.navbar-item.is-active{color:rgba(0,0,0,.7)}a.navbar-item.is-active:not(:focus):not(:hover){background-color:transparent}.columns:not(.is-tablet){display:flex;flex-direction:row}.reverse:not(.is-tablet){flex-direction:row-reverse}}@media screen and (min-width:1216px){.container:not(.is-max-desktop){max-width:1152px}}@media screen and (min-width:1408px){.container:not(.is-max-desktop):not(.is-max-widescreen){max-width:1344px}}@media screen and (max-width:1023px){.navbar>.container{display:block}.navbar-brand .navbar-item{align-items:center;display:flex}.navbar-menu{background-color:#efefef;box-shadow:0 8px 8px rgba(0,0,0,.1);padding:.5rem 0}.navbar-menu.is-active{display:block}.navbar .navbar-menu{-webkit-overflow-scrolling:touch;max-height:calc(100vh - 3.5rem);overflow:auto}.hero.is-primary .navbar-menu{background-color:#62781e}.hero.is-link .navbar-menu{background-color:#86a623}}@media print,screen and (min-width:769px){.column.is-one-third{flex:none;width:33.3333%}h1.column{flex:none;width:8.33333337%}h2.column{flex:none;width:16.66666674%}h3.column{flex:none;width:25%}.column.is-4{flex:none;width:33.33333337%}.column.is-8{flex:none;width:66.66666674%}.columns:not(.is-desktop){display:flex}.hero-body{padding:3rem}}